LC: Non hypothetical hypothetical
 
You are playing a 4 game set. You lose your connection just as you've finished two of them. You're chip leader on one with 5 left and you're mid stack with 6 left. No one can play for you. You rush to a friends house to use his computer. When you get there you've already lost both tournies. Should you count these two tournies towards your ROI if you keep track?

Yeh you should. ROI isn't used to track skill (although over a large sample ROI can reflect skill level), but to track your return. In the big grand scheme of things a loss every now and then won't make much of a difference in ROI anyway.
